BREAKING: Albon to replace Russell at Williams in 2022

Alexander Albon returns to Formula 1 at Williams. The Red Bull protégé will replace George Russell at Williams. Williams had a lot of drivers to choose from, but ended up with the Thai. Nicholas Latifi, who is in his second season at the team, will also retain his seat, despite speculation that he would also depart. Albon has had a remarkable career in motorsport so far. At a young age he was accepted into Red Bull's training programme, but when his mother was sent to prison his performance on the track declined.
